Coax connectors perform up to 110GHz
The W1 connector is a coaxial interface system with excellent RF performance up to 110GHz, making it well suited for high frequency applications ranging from components to systems and instruments.

The W1 connector is a coaxial interface system that produces excellent RF performance up to 110GHz, making it well suited for high frequency applications ranging from components to systems and instrumentation. Based on the 1.00 mm coaxial connector front side interface as specified by IEEE287, the design of the W1 connector family is intended for high-end performance. No other connector series matches the performance and reliability of the W1 connectors at such a high frequency.
The complete connector offering includes both male and female sparkplug connectors, as well as a female flange mount connector.
The centre conductor of the sparkplug connectors is supported by Anritsu's proprietary low loss, high temperature plastic bead on one end and a Teflon bead on the other to provide exceptional concentricity to the pin on the back side.
The flange mount connector's centre conductor is supported by a PPO bead on the front end and by a Teflon bead on the back end.
Both the sparkplug and the female flange mount connectors are designed so that the centre conductor extends outside the connector, allowing a direct pin overlap connection to the microwave circuit.
The connectors have 50ohm impedance, typical return loss of -16dB to 110GHz, typical insertion loss of 0.7dB on the sparkplug connectors and 0.6dB on the flange mount connector, and offer superior reliability.
Anritsu has also developed W1 in-series adapters for use with the W1 connector family.
Available in M-M, M-F, or F-F configurations, the precision adapters have an air dielectric interface and a centre conductor that is supported by a PPO bead.
The maximum return loss is -16dB and the maximum insertion loss is 0.5dB.
In addition, the W1 connector family includes male and female 1mm broadband terminations with -16dB return loss (1.33 VSWR) for the male and -14dB return loss (1.5 VSWR) for the female.
